5. Pin Descriptions Of Major Components
5.2 SiS630S Slot 1/Socket 370 2D/3D Ultra-AGP™ Single Chipset
PCI Interface
Name Tolerance Power
Plane
Type
Attr
Description
STOP#
3.3V/5V MAIN I/O
Stop# :
STOP# indicates that the bus master must start
terminating its current PCI bus cycle at the next
clock edge and release control of the PCI bus. STOP#
is used for disconnection, retry, and target-abortion
sequences on the PCI bus.
DEVSEL#
3.3V/5V MAIN I/O
Device Select :
As a PCI target, SiS Chip asserts
DEVSEL# by doing positive or subtractive decoding.
SiS Chip positively asserts DEVSEL# when the
DRAM address is being accessed by a PCI master, PCI
configuration registers or embedded controllers’
registers are being addressed, or the BIOS memory
space is being accessed. The low 16K I/O space and
low 16M memory space are responded subtractively.
The DEVESEL# is an input pin when SiS Chip is
acting as a PCI master. It is asserted by the addressed
agent to claim the current transaction.
PLOCK#
3.3V/5V MAIN I/O
PCI Lock :
When PLOCK# is sampled asserted at the
beginning of a PCI cycle, SiS630 considers itself being
locked and remains in the locked state until PLOCK#
is sampled and negated at the following PCI cycle.
PREQ[2:0]#
3.3V/5V MAIN I
PCI Bus Request :
PCI Bus Master Request Signals
PGNT[2:0]#
3.3V MAIN O
PCI Bus Grant :
PCI Bus Master Grant Signals
INT[A:D]#
3.3V/5V MAIN I
PCI interrupt A,B,C,D :
The PCI interrupts will be
connected to the inputs of the internal Interrupt
controller through the rerouting logic associated with
each PCI interrupt.
PCIRST#
3.3V AUX O
PCI Bus Reset :
PCIRST# will be asserted during
the period when PWROK is low, and will be kept on
asserting until about 24ms after PWROK goes high.
SERR#
3.3V/5V MAIN I
System Error :
When sampled active low, a non-
maskable interrupt (NMI) can be generated to CPU if
enabled.
